MEMO — Kettling Depot Receiving

Uniform sets for the new Kettling depot arrive Wednesday via Ashgrove courier: 40 boxes, sorted by size, manifest attached to box one. Check the count at the dock before signing; shortages go straight to stores, not the courier. The hand-over instruction the courier will follow is set out below.

drop instructions, tafof-baguf: the holmir gilox courier leaves the sormir ulaok holdor ledger at gate 5596 under passcode 257343

Subject: Partner SFTP drop — new owner

Hi,

As you review the pending changes to the Harborline ingest scripts, note that ownership of the partner SFTP drop is changing at the end of the month. This includes key rotation, the nightly pull job, and the quarantine folder for malformed files. Review comments on the retry logic should still go through the normal PR flow, but questions about drop-folder conventions or partner onboarding now go to the new owner. The incoming owner is listed below.

signatory, tagaf-bahaf: Praael Fenmir Rusok

Ticket: Staging env misconfigured for Siftgate bloom filter

The bloom layer in front of the Pellet KV store is rejecting all lookups in staging because the env file was copied from the dev template without credentials. False-positive tuning values are fine; only the auth line is missing. To unblock the weekly demo, the Pellet admission secret must be set on the following line.

env line for yaguf-fajop: LEDGER_TOKEN13=fb08984397349

Team — Thursday we run the disaster-recovery drill for the Ledgerwick tax-rate lookup cache. Expect the cache to go cold for about twenty minutes; route rate questions to the fallback table. During the drill, restoring the warm snapshot requires authenticating to the recovery console, so have the passphrase below ready when prompted.

vault phrase of kawep-tahog = ulaix-briath

# Seat-map renderer constants — StageGrid module
#
# These values control how the Marlowe Playhouse seat map is drawn in the
# booking widget. Support staff: if customers report overlapping seats or
# blurry section labels, the usual cause is a venue layout exceeding the
# default grid bounds, not a browser issue. Changing these constants
# requires a cache flush on the render workers, so coordinate with the
# on-call engineer before editing. The current tuning constants are
# listed below.

limits module of tageg-tajog:
QUOTAS = {
    "kasax": 140,
    "wenath": 802,
}